The Humble Beginnings: From Egg to Caterpillar
The life cycle of a caterpillar begins as a tiny, unassuming egg. These eggs, often concealed within leaves or other vegetation, are laid by adult butterflies, moths, or skippers. As temperatures rise, the egg’s dormant embryo awakens, starting its intricate development into a voracious caterpillar.
The Larval Stage: Caterpillar’s Hungry Days
Upon hatching, the newly emerged caterpillar is a tiny and insatiable creature. Its primary objective is to consume leaves, providing it with the necessary energy and nutrients for growth. Caterpillars possess unique mouthparts, known as mandibles, which allow them to munch on leaves with impressive efficiency.
The Transformation to Pupae: A Time of Quiet Metamorphosis
After reaching a certain size, the caterpillar prepares for the next stage of its life cycle. It spins a silken cocoon around itself, providing a protective shelter as it undergoes a remarkable transformation. Within the confines of the pupa, the caterpillar’s body undergoes a dramatic reorganization. Its old tissues are broken down and rebuilt, giving rise to the adult form.
The Emergence of Adult Lepidoptera: Grace and Freedom
When the metamorphosis is complete, the adult butterfly, moth, or skipper emerges from its pupa. It’s a moment of beauty and liberation as the creature takes its first flight. The wings, which were once hidden within the caterpillar’s body, now unfurl, revealing intricate patterns and vibrant hues.
The Circle of Life: From Wings to Eggs
Adult Lepidoptera have a finite lifespan, during which they mate and lay eggs, ensuring the continuation of the species. These eggs will hatch into new caterpillars, perpetuating the cycle of transformation and renewal in the world of Lepidoptera.

Physical Characteristics
Caterpillars exhibit a remarkable diversity in size, color, and markings. They can range in length from a mere few millimeters to an impressive 15 centimeters or more. The colors span a vibrant spectrum, from subtle greens and browns to bold reds, yellows, and blacks. Markings can include stripes, spots, lines, and intricate patterns that aid in camouflage and defense.
Size
Size is a useful characteristic for narrowing down your identification options. Determine the approximate length of the caterpillar and compare it to the measurements provided in field guides.
Color and Markings
Coloration and markings are often distinctive for specific caterpillar species. Pay attention to the overall color, as well as any unique patterns, stripes, or spots.
Head and Body Shape
The shape of the caterpillar’s head and body can also provide clues. Some species have smooth, rounded heads, while others have more angular or pointed ones. The shape of the body can vary from cylindrical to flattened or spiny.
Identification Guides and Resources
Several comprehensive identification guides are available to assist with the challenging task of caterpillar identification. These resources provide detailed descriptions, photographs, and illustrations to aid in accurate determination. Field guides such as Butterflies and Moths of North America by James A. Scott and _ Caterpillars of Eastern North America_ by David L. Wagner are highly recommended.
Online Resources
The internet offers a wealth of online resources for caterpillar identification. Websites such as BugGuide and Caterpillar Central provide extensive databases with images, descriptions, and distribution maps. These tools can be invaluable for expanding your knowledge and narrowing down your options.

Threats to Caterpillar Populations
Caterpillar habitats, such as forests, grasslands, and wetlands, are dwindling due to urban development, deforestation, and agricultural expansion. Pesticide use, a common practice in pest control, poses a grave danger to caterpillars, poisoning their food sources and disrupting their life cycles.
